If you were injured in a drunk driving accident while an occupant of a motor vehicle or as a pedestrian, and it can be determined that the drunk driver that caused the accident was over-served by a bartender or restaurant, and then allowed to drive home, you may be able to old the restaurant or bar liable for the accident and your injuries. A handful of states do not allow "happy hours," or a time when drinks are discounted, usually immediately after the end of the typical workday. Most states that have dram shop laws imposed liability only in situations where the alcohol seller provided alcohol in an unlawful manner. For example, in California, dram shop liability attaches where a vendor provides alcohol to an underage person but not for serving a person who's already visibly intoxicated. The Act requires all states to either set their minimum age to purchase alcoholic beverages and the minimum age to possess alcoholic beverages in public to no lower than 21 years of age or lose 10% (Changed to 8% in 2012) of their allocated federal highway funding if the minimum age for the aforementioned is lower than 21 years of age.
